Output 7215ee4ef955f2da78dcfe96e3f6ae9c8e7dd47eb74a2ca17bcef94558b62d63:71

value
136379498
script pubkey
OP_0 OP_PUSHBYTES_20 f3eac3640f8fcad8b47a23facdc20add1feff1b1
address
bc1q704vxeq03l9d3dr6y0avmss2m507lud3mlm4fw
transaction
7215ee4ef955f2da78dcfe96e3f6ae9c8e7dd47eb74a2ca17bcef94558b62d63
spent
true